The Itinerary Breakdown: What You Can Expect

Day 1: From Hanoi to Cao Bang

Your adventure begins early, with pickup around 5:50 am from your Hanoi hotel. Expect a comfortable transfer by limousine or shared car, taking roughly 6 hours to reach Cao Bang City. The early start is worth it—this gives you a full day of sightseeing once you arrive.

Upon arrival, there’s a warm welcome from the Vietnam Northern Travel team, followed by check-in at a local hotel or homestay. After a hearty lunch, the real exploration starts. You’ll hop on motorbikes—a key feature of this tour—and explore Cao Bang Geopark, a site of geological significance and natural beauty. Visiting Nung Chi Cao Temple, dedicated to a hero of the Tay Nung tribes, adds a historical touch.

In the late afternoon, you’ll wander along the Bang River promenade, soaking in the city’s charm. The evening features a chance to sample local delicacies, including Cao Bang sausage, which reviewers praise as truly unique.

Day 2: Mountain Passes, Magic Eye Mountain & Pac Bo Cave

The day kicks off early with a regional breakfast of Cao Bang rice paper and mountain vegetables, giving you a genuine taste of local flavors. The first highlight is the drive along Ma Phuc Pass, where you’ll see old stilt houses and lush jungles—think of it as a scene straight out of a postcard.

Next, you’ll visit the Magic Eye Mountain, a spot that travelers describe as a place where you can feel your soul reconnect with nature. The panoramic views of Keo Yen and Lung Luong Ammonites add to the awe.

As you continue through the quiet routes of Cao Bang’s villages, you’ll see broad landscapes, rice paddies, and ethnic hamlets of the Tay, Nùng, and Dao tribes. Reviewers mention that these routes are so scenic with few trucks or heavy vehicles, making the journey peaceful and immersive.

In the afternoon, the trip takes you to Pac Bo Cave, where Ho Chi Minh returned after 30 years of searching for a way to lead Vietnam to independence. Visiting the stream, mountains, and the site itself, you’ll feel the weight of history amid stunning natural surroundings. The nearby Kim Dongs Tomb honors a teenage hero, adding a poignant note to the visit.

As the tour winds down, a different scenic route takes you back to Cao Bang city, ending with a dinner of local dishes like duck noodle soup or sour noodle before heading back to Hanoi by sleeper bus or private transfer.

Transportation and Practical Details

The core of this tour is motorbike riding, which means you’ll see the countryside in a very intimate way—feeling the wind, smelling the earth, and hearing the sounds of village life. The bikes are provided for free, though private riders or cars can be pre-arranged at extra cost, offering flexibility if you prefer a more comfortable ride or traveling with a group.

The overall schedule is tightly packed, with most stops lasting around 2 to 4 hours. The early starts and late returns are typical for this type of trip, designed to maximize sightseeing but requiring good stamina.

Accommodation is at a 2-star hotel or homestay, offering a basic but authentic stay that complements the rural experience. Meals are included, with local dishes praised for their flavor and authenticity—reviewers highlight the quality of food, especially breakfast and dinner options.

The tour’s total price of $139 offers good value, considering transportation, meals, accommodations, and entrance fees are all included. Optional extras like air-conditioned vehicles or private transfers are available at additional costs, so plan accordingly if comfort is a priority.
